H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. This page needs HTML code to be minified as it can gain 3.3 kB, which is 20% of the original size.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 12.5 kB or 78% of the original size.

It’s better to minify JavaScript in order to improve website performance. The diagram shows the current total size of all JavaScript files against the prospective JavaScript size after its minification and compression. It is highly recommended that all JavaScript files should be compressed and minified as it can save up to 15.5 kB or 34% of the original size.
Potential reduce by 157.7 kB
CSS files minification is very important to reduce a web page rendering time. The faster CSS files can load, the earlier a page can be rendered. Ucrcard.ucr.edu needs all CSS files to be minified and compressed as it can save up to 157.7 kB or 82% of the original size.
